SIX students in the Worth Valley have benefited from a grant scheme set up more than 100 years ago.

The Haworth Exhibition Trust has made six grants of up to £125 to local students.

Spokesman Tony Maw said: “This is a means of offsetting some of the costs of further and higher education.

“The successful applicants intend to use the money as a contribution to the cost of books.

“The trust, which is an old established one, exists to help young people going to university or other further educational institutions, provided they live in Haworth, Oxenhope or Stanbury.”
